2. Inspection of the packaging: the first signs of damage
An unprepared buyer often misses this stage, but in vain: damaged packaging is the first signal of possible problems. The box must be inspected by the courier, even before unpacking the equipment. Pay attention to:
- 📦 Dents or punctures on the cardboard walls (especially dangerous in the compressor area)
- 💦 Traces of moisture (may indicate transportation in the rain or condensation inside)
- 🔄 Taped seams (possible attempt to hide the opening of the box)
- 📉 Sagging of the bottom of the box (a sign of impact during loading)
If the packaging is damaged, Do not sign receipt documents before the refrigerator is completely checked. According to Law "On Protection of Consumer Rights" (Article 18), you have the right to refuse goods with packaging defects, even if the equipment itself is outwardly intact. Take photographs of all damage from different angles - these photos will be useful for your claim.
What to do if the courier refuses to wait for inspection?
If the courier is in a hurry and does not give time for check, politely remind him of clause 4 of Art. 497 of the Civil Code of the Russian Federation: “The buyer has the right to refuse the goods if he is not given the opportunity to inspect the goods at the time of delivery.” In most cases this works. If not, call the store’s support service and ask to replace the courier or reschedule delivery.
3. Unpacking and external inspection of the refrigerator
After inspecting the box, proceed to unpacking. Do this carefully so as not to scratch the glossy surfaces (relevant for models Samsung RB37A5200 or LG GC-B247SLUV with coating AntiFingerprint). It is better to film the process - this is additional insurance in case of hidden defects.
What to pay attention to during an external inspection:
| Element | What to check | Permissible standards |
|---|---|---|
| Case | Scratches, chips, dents | Micro abrasions on the back wall are allowed |
| Doors | Seal seal tightness, distortions | Gap no more than 2 mm, uniform fit |
| Display (if any) | Screen integrity, sensor operation | No dead pixels, all menu functions are active |
| Legs | Stability, adjustable height | The refrigerator does not wobble, the legs are fixed |
| Compressor | No traces of oil, integrity of the tubes | The tubes are not deformed, there are no drips |
Pay special attention sealing rubber to the door. Do a test with a sheet of paper: close the door on the sheet and try to pull it out. If the sheet comes out without effort, the seal is damaged and the refrigerator will not freeze well. For models with a system No Frost (for example, Atlant XM 4625-101) this is critical - a loose fit will lead to icing of the evaporator.

5. Test switching on: how to check functionality
Many buyers are afraid to turn on the refrigerator immediately after delivery, and in vain. Short-term test (5-10 minutes) will help identify obvious faults. Here's what you need to do:
- Connect the refrigerator to a grounded outlet (not through an extension cord!).
- Set the thermostat to a medium value (for example,
+4°Cfor the refrigerator compartment). - Check if the indicators light up (if the model has them).
- Listen to the operation of the compressor: it should start in 1-2 minutes with a slight hum, without grinding or knocking.
- Make sure that the fan No Frost (if any) rotates without extraneous noise.
What should alert:
- 🔊 Severe noise or vibration (may indicate improper installation or damage to the compressor)
- 💨 Lack of cold air from the vents after 15-20 minutes
- 🚨 Flashing error indicators (for example
E1orF2on the display) - 💧 The appearance of a puddle under the refrigerator (a sign of freon or condensate leakage)
If the refrigerator is equipped with a system Smart Diagnosis (as y LG), run self-diagnosis through the mobile application. This will take 2-3 minutes, but will reveal hidden errors that are not visible during visual inspection.
6. Typical mistakes during acceptance and how to avoid them
Experienced sellers and couriers sometimes take advantage of buyers’ ignorance to save time or hide defects. Here are the most common pitfalls and how to get around them:
- 📦 "The packaging is damaged, but the refrigerator is intact" - in fact, shocks during transportation can damage the internal tubes or electronics. Request to open the box and inspect the equipment.
- ⏳ "No time to wait, sign quickly" - the courier has no right to rush you. Refer to Art. 497 of the Civil Code of the Russian Federation on the right to inspection.
- 🔄 "The defect is minor, we will fix it under warranty" - minor scratches may be a sign of a fall. Refuse such a product - the warranty does not cover mechanical damage.
- 📄 "We will fill out the warranty card later" - without seal and date of sale, the guarantee is invalid. Require everything to be completed on the spot.
Another mistake is ignoring checking the noise level. Many models (for example Beko GNE114620X) in the first hours of operation may make atypical sounds due to unstabilized freon pressure. If the noise does not disappear after 24 hours, this is a reason to contact the service.
⚠️ Attention: If the refrigerator was delivered in a horizontal position (lying down), do not turn it on immediately! Compressor oil may have entered the cooling circuit. Let the equipment sit 6-12 hours in a vertical position before turning it on for the first time.
7. What to do if defects are found
If damage or malfunctions are revealed during inspection, follow the algorithm:
- Do not sign the documents on receipt. Write on the invoice: "The goods have not been inspected, there are no complaints" - this will preserve your rights.
- Take photographs of the defects from different angles, including packaging. The serial number of the refrigerator should be visible in the photo.
- Draw up a report in the presence of the courier. Indicate:
- Date and time of delivery
- Model and serial number of the refrigerator
- Description of defects (with photo attached)
- Courier signatures and your
If the store refuses to acknowledge the claim, write an official complaint addressed to the director with indicating:
- 📌 Dates of purchase and delivery
- 📌 Order numbers
- 📌 Descriptions of defects (with link to photo/video)
- 📌 Requirements: replacement, repair or return money
Send your complaint by registered mail with notification. In most cases, this is enough to solve the problem. If not, contact Rospotrebnadzor or the court.
Time limits for consideration of the claim
By law, the store is obliged to consider the claim within 10 days (Article 21 of the Law "On the Protection of Consumer Rights"). For technically complex products (which include a refrigerator), the repair or replacement period should not exceed 45 days. If the store violates these terms, you have the right to demand a penalty in the amount of 1% of the cost of the goods for each day of delay.
FAQ: Answers to frequently asked questions
Is it possible to refuse a refrigerator if it does not fit in size?
Yes, if the refrigerator is not built-in and was not installed consumption. According to Art. 25 of the Law “On the Protection of Consumer Rights”, you can return the product within 7 days if it does not suit the shape, size or color. The main thing is to preserve the packaging, seals and presentation. In the case of equipment, they are often required to pay logistics costs (up to 10% of the cost).
The courier insists on signing the act without inspection. What to do?
Politely but persistently refuse. Refer to paragraph 4 of Art. 497 of the Civil Code of the Russian Federation, which gives the right to inspect the goods before acceptance. If the courier refuses to wait, call the store's customer service and request that the delivery be rescheduled or the courier replaced. Record the conversation on a voice recorder - this will be useful for filing a complaint.
Do you need to wash the refrigerator before turning it on for the first time?
Yes, but not right away. First, let the equipment stand for 2-3 hours at room temperature. Then wipe the internal surfaces with a weak solution of soda (1 tablespoon per 1 liter of water) or a special product for refrigerators. Do not use aggressive chemicals - they can damage the plastic and leave an odor. After washing, let the chambers dry, then turn on the refrigerator.
What to do if the refrigerator was delivered without a warranty card?
This is a gross violation. The warranty card is a mandatory document; its absence deprives you of the right to free repairs. They ask the courier to return the refrigerator or provide a coupon. If they refuse, write a complaint to the store demanding delivery of the document within 3 days. If there is no response, contact Rospotrebnadzor.
Is it possible to turn on the refrigerator immediately after delivery in winter?
No. If the equipment was transported at a temperature below +5°C, it should be allowed to warm up to room temperature (about 2-3 hours). A sudden change can cause condensation in the cooling system and compressor breakdown. This rule applies to all models, including No Frost.
